Rövid útmutató: Használati logikai alkalmazás munkafolyamatának létrehozása és üzembe helyezése több-bérlős Azure Logic Appsben ARM-sablonnal
A következőkre vonatkozik: Azure Logic Apps (Használat)
Az Azure Logic Apps egy felhőalapú szolgáltatás, amely több száz összekötő közül választva segít olyan automatizált munkafolyamatok létrehozásában és futtatásában, amelyek több száz összekötő közül választva integrálják az adatokat, alkalmazásokat, felhőalapú szolgáltatásokat és helyszíni rendszereket. Ez a rövid útmutató egy Azure Resource Manager-sablon (ARM-sablon) üzembe helyezésének folyamatával foglalkozik, amely létrehoz egy alapszintű használatalapú logikai alkalmazás-munkafolyamatot, amely óránként ellenőrzi az Azure állapotát, és több-bérlős Azure Logic Appsben fut.
Az Azure Resource Manager-sablon egy JavaScript Object Notation (JSON) fájl, amely meghatározza a projekt infrastruktúráját és konfigurációját. A sablon deklaratív szintaxist használ. Az üzembe helyezés létrehozásához szükséges programozási parancsok sorozatának megírása nélkül írhatja le a tervezett üzembe helyezést.
Ha a környezet megfelel az előfeltételeknek, és ismeri az ARM-sablonok használatát, válassza az Üzembe helyezés az Azure-ban gombot. A sablon az Azure Portalon fog megnyílni.
Előfeltételek
Ha nem rendelkezik Azure-előfizetéssel, a kezdés előtt hozzon létre egy ingyenes Azure-fiókot .
A sablon áttekintése
Ez a rövid útmutató a Logikai alkalmazás létrehozása sablont használja, amelyet az Azure Rövid útmutatósablonok gyűjteményében talál, de túl hosszú ahhoz, hogy megjelenjen itt. Ehelyett áttekintheti a sablon "azuredeploy.json fájlját " a sablonok gyűjteményében.
A rövid útmutatósablon létrehoz egy használatalapú logikai alkalmazás munkafolyamatot, amely a beépített ismétlődési eseményindítót használja, amely óránként fut, és egy beépített HTTP-művelet, amely meghív egy URL-címet, amely az Azure állapotát adja vissza. A beépített műveletek natív módon futnak az Azure Logic Apps platformon.
Ez a sablon a következő Azure-erőforrást hozza létre:
- Microsoft.Logic/workflows, amely létrehozza a munkafolyamatot egy használatalapú logikai alkalmazás erőforrásához.
Az Azure Logic Appshez készült gyorsútmutató-sablonokért tekintse át a Microsoft.Logic-sablonokat a katalógusban.
A sablon üzembe helyezése
Kövesse a gyorsútmutató-sablon üzembe helyezéséhez használni kívánt beállítást:
Lehetőség | Leírás |
---|---|
Azure Portalra | Ha az Azure-környezet megfelel az előfeltételeknek, és ismeri az ARM-sablonok használatát, ezek a lépések segítenek közvetlenül az Azure-ba bejelentkezni, és megnyitni a rövid útmutatósablont az Azure Portalon. További információ: Erőforrások üzembe helyezése ARM-sablonokkal és Azure Portallal. |
Azure CLI | Az Azure CLI parancssori felületet biztosít az Azure-erőforrások létrehozásához és kezeléséhez. A parancsok futtatásához az Azure CLI 2.6-os vagy újabb verziójára van szükség. A parancssori felület verziójának ellenőrzéséhez adja meg az --version értéket. További információkért tekintse meg a következő dokumentációt: - Mi az Azure CLI? - Az Azure CLI használatának első lépései |
Azure PowerShell | Az Azure PowerShell olyan parancsmagok készletét kínálja, amelyek az Azure Resource Manager modellt használják az Azure-erőforrások kezeléséhez. További információkért tekintse meg a következő dokumentációt: - Az Azure PowerShell áttekintése - Az Azure PowerShell Az modul bemutatása - Ismerkedés az Azure PowerShell szolgáltatással |
Azure Resource Management REST API | Az Azure reprezentációs állapotátviteli (REST) API-kat biztosít, amelyek olyan szolgáltatásvégpontok, amelyek támogatják a HTTP-műveleteket (metódusokat), amelyeket a szolgáltatáserőforrásokhoz való hozzáférés létrehozásához, lekéréséhez, frissítéséhez vagy törléséhez használ. További információ: Ismerkedés az Azure REST API-val. |
Ha azure-fiókjával szeretne bejelentkezni, és meg szeretné nyitni a rövid útmutatósablont az Azure Portalon, válassza a következő képet:
A portálon a Logikai alkalmazás létrehozása sablonlapon adja meg vagy válassza ki a következő értékeket:
Tulajdonság Érték Leírás Előfizetés <Azure-előfizetés-neve> A használni kívánt Azure-előfizetés neve Erőforráscsoport <Azure-erőforráscsoport-neve> Egy új vagy meglévő Azure-erőforráscsoport neve. Ez a példa a Check-Azure-Status-RG-t használja. Régió <Azure-régió> Az Azure-adatközpont régiója a logikai alkalmazás használatához. Ez a példa az USA nyugati régióját használja. Logikai alkalmazás neve <logic-app-name> A logikai alkalmazáshoz használandó név. Ez a példa a Check-Azure-Status-LA-t használja. Uri tesztelése <test-URI> A szolgáltatás URI-ja egy adott ütemezés alapján. Ez a példa az Azure állapotoldalát használja https://azure.status.microsoft/en-us/status/. Helyen <Azure-region-for-all-resources> Az azure-régió, amelyet az összes erőforráshoz használni kell, ha eltér az alapértelmezett értéktől. Ez a példa az alapértelmezett [resourceGroup().location] értéket használja, amely az erőforráscsoport helye. Az alábbi példa bemutatja, hogyan néz ki a lap mintaértékekkel:
Ha elkészült, válassza a Véleményezés + létrehozás lehetőséget.
Folytassa az üzembe helyezett erőforrások áttekintésével kapcsolatos lépésekkel.
Üzembe helyezett erőforrások áttekintése
A logikai alkalmazás munkafolyamatának megtekintéséhez használhatja az Azure Portalt, futtathat egy, az Azure CLI-vel vagy az Azure PowerShell-lel létrehozott szkriptet, vagy használhatja a Logic App REST API-t.
Az Azure Portal keresőmezőjébe írja be a logikai alkalmazás nevét, amely ebben a példában a Check-Azure-Status-LA . Az eredmények listájában válassza ki a logikai alkalmazást.
Az Azure Portalon keresse meg és válassza ki a jelen példában a Check-Azure-Status-RG nevű logikai alkalmazást.
Amikor megnyílik a munkafolyamat-tervező, tekintse át a gyorsútmutató-sablon által létrehozott logikai alkalmazás munkafolyamatát.
A logikai alkalmazás teszteléséhez a tervező eszköztárán válassza a Futtatás lehetőséget.
Az erőforrások eltávolítása
Ha további rövid útmutatókkal és oktatóanyagokkal szeretne dolgozni, érdemes lehet megtartania ezeket az erőforrásokat. Ha már nincs szüksége a logikai alkalmazásra, törölje az erőforráscsoportot az Azure Portal, az Azure CLI, az Azure PowerShell vagy a Resource Management REST API használatával.
Az Azure Portalon keresse meg és válassza ki a törölni kívánt erőforráscsoportot, amely ebben a példában a Check-Azure-Status-RG .
Az erőforráscsoport menüjében válassza az Áttekintés lehetőséget, ha még nincs kijelölve. Az áttekintési lapon válassza az Erőforráscsoport törlése lehetőséget.
A megerősítéshez adja meg az erőforráscsoport nevét.
További információ: Erőforráscsoport törlése.